Also, anyone that wants to set-up a HT contest can do so, it doesn't have to be me. You just have to set-up the contest at HT (takes 90 seconds), copy the link provided, then send it to interested players. The only limitation is the short-notice for sending out the link (about 24hrs.), but if you can drum up interest in advance, it should go smoothly.
